Apache Fineract CN 测试库安装与使用指南

Apache Fineract CN 测试库安装与使用指南

fineract-cn-testApache Fineract CN library to support unit, component, and integration testing for services and libraries.项目地址:https://gitcode.com/gh_mirrors/fi/fineract-cn-test

目录结构及介绍

在下载并解压 apache/fineract-cn-test 的源代码之后,你会看到以下主要目录和文件:

根目录

根目录包含了整个项目的顶层结构。这里包括了Gradle构建脚本和其他一些元数据。

子目录
  • src: 源码的主要目录,包含Java源文件。
    • main: 包含应用的主资源和源代码
      • java: Java源代码
      • resources: 应用所需的资源文件
    • test: 包含用于单元测试的资源和源代码
      • java: 单元测试的Java类
      • resources: 测试所需的资源文件
  • .gitignore: Git忽略文件列表,定义了不应被版本控制的文件和目录。
  • HEADER: 许可证头部模板,用于所有源代码和文档文件。
  • LICENSE: 定义了软件的许可证(Apache-2.0)。
  • NOTICE.txt: 提供有关第三方依赖和贡献者的版权声明的信息。
  • README.md: 项目描述和说明文档。
  • build.gradle: Gradle构建脚本,定义了项目的构建逻辑。
  • settings.gradle: 配置多项目构建的设置。
  • gradlewgradlew.bat: 跨平台的构建包装器脚本,用于运行Gradle任务。

启动文件介绍

项目中的启动点通常涉及到测试框架服务组件的初始化,但是由于这是一个专注于单元和集成测试的库,没有单一的传统“入口点”如应用程序主类。相反,构建和执行测试是主要的操作。

  • gradlew test: 这个命令将执行所有的单元和集成测试。

  • 在进行任何修改之前,请确保使用./gradlew clean清空之前的构建结果,然后通过./gradlew assemble来构建项目。

配置文件介绍

配置通常是特定于环境和使用的组件。在apache/fineract-cn-test中,大多数配置可能位于src/main/resources下的.properties文件或YAML文件中,具体取决于你选择使用的组件或服务。

例如,对于数据库连接,一个典型的配置可能是类似这样的:

spring.datasource.url=jdbc:mysql://localhost/testdb?useSSL=false&serverTimezone=UTC
spring.datasource.username=root
spring.datasource.password=password

然而,在apache/fineract-cn-test中,这些具体的配置可能更多地出现在测试代码和资源文件中,因为库本身更侧重于提供测试支持而不是作为独立的服务运行。

为了自定义测试行为,开发者应该检查和调整相应测试框架(如JUnit或TestNG)以及相关组件和服务的配置参数,以满足其特定的需求。

请注意,实际配置可能会因具体实现而异,以上提供的只是一个一般性的指导示例。如果你正在处理特定的集成或服务,确保参考该服务的官方文档来了解如何正确配置它。


总结来说,理解项目的目录结构可以帮助定位源代码、资源和构建相关的文件;而熟悉启动过程则有助于快速上手运行和调试;最后,掌握基本的配置方法能够让你更好地定制和扩展你的测试能力。这三点是使用和维护 apache/fineract-cn-test 或者任何类似的测试库的关键。希望这份简介对你的开发工作有所帮助!


由于这个开源项目的特定用途,上述解释和概述可能需要结合项目本身的代码阅读和实验,才能获得完整的理解和适用性。

fineract-cn-testApache Fineract CN library to support unit, component, and integration testing for services and libraries.项目地址:https://gitcode.com/gh_mirrors/fi/fineract-cn-test

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

劳阔印

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值